Studi Hermeneutika terhadap Relasi Korban Abraham dengan Pengorbanan Yesus Adi, Didit Yuliantono; Simon, Simon
KARDIA: Jurnal Teologi dan Pendidikan Kristiani Vol. 1 No. 2 (2023): Agustus 2023
Publisher : Sekolah Tinggi Teologi Parakletos Tomohon

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.69932/kardia.v1i2.13

Abstract

Abstract: This article specifically discusses how hermeneutics studies the correlation between Abraham's sacrifice and Jesus' sacrifice. This topic is elaborated by the author based on the author's attention to the difference of opinion among believers regarding Abraham's sacrifice, which is a typology of Jesus' sacrifice. The difference of opinion is marked by the view that the typology of Jesus' sacrifice is Ihsak, but there are also those who agree that the typology of Jesus' sacrifice is the sheep. All of these opinions share the same biblical basis as a theological basis for the relationship between Abraham's sacrifice and Jesus' sacrifice. On this basis, the author uses the literature study method with an exegesis approach. The purpose of this study is to connect the common thread of Abraham's sacrifice and its relationship to Christ's sacrifice. By explaining, it gives an understanding that God's plan of salvation for sinful man through His Son was long prophesied in the Old Testament. The findings of this topic reveal that the Old Testament through the New Testament broadly tell of the prophecy and fulfillment of Jesus' sacrifice. Menjawab Tuduhan Comma Johanneum 1 Yohanes 5:7-8 Sebagai Ayat Palsu Melalui Tulisan Bapa-Bapa Gereja Didit Yuliantono Adi; Yohanes Twintarto Agus Indratno
Philoxenia: Jurnal Teologi dan Pendidikan Kristiani Vol. 2 No. 2 (2024): Philoxenia: Jurnal Teologi dan Pendidikan Kristiani
Publisher : Sekolah Tinggi Teologi Kalvary - Maluku Utara

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.59386/7nndas83

Abstract

The idea for writing this scientific work came from the author's ministry experience, which often encountered questions about the inerrancy of the Bible, especially regarding the authenticity of 1 John 5:7-8 or the Comma Johanneum. The purpose of writing this scientific work is to find evidence that 1 John 5:7-8 is the Word of God revealed to the apostle John. The method used in this writing is a qualitative method with a literature study approach. From this research, evidence was found that, although the Comma Johanneum is not found in ancient Greek texts, this verse can be traced to an ancient Latin document called the Vetus Latina and from the writings of the church fathers, namely Tertullian, Ciprian, Athanasius, Origen, Augustine , Pricilian, Jerome, Gregory Nazianus and Johanes Chrisostomos whose writings still exist and have been preserved to this day. Thus the accusation that this verse is fake or a hoax has been successfully refuted.
Penyembah-Penyembah Benar Menurut Yohanes 4:23: Kaitannya Terhadap Pengenalan Akan Allah Didit Yuliantono Adi; Endik Firmansah
Philoxenia: Jurnal Teologi dan Pendidikan Kristiani Vol. 3 No. 2 (2025): Philoxenia: Jurnal Teologi dan Pendidikan Kristiani - Mei 2025
Publisher : Sekolah Tinggi Teologi Kalvary - Maluku Utara

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.59386/wny80891

Abstract

This scientific study aims to explore the meaning of true worship according to John 4:23 and its relation to knowing God. True worship must be grounded in the three essential aspects of the Christian faith: orthodoxy (right doctrine), orthopraxy (right practice), and ortholatry (right worship). The truth in this context is not philosophical or anthropocentric but Christocentric, with Scripture as its ultimate standard. God is both the foundation and the ultimate goal of all Christian reality. As the Creator, He sovereignly rules over all of life. He alone is worthy of worship and glorification. Scripture explicitly describes worshiping God as being conducted "in spirit and truth." Since God is Spirit, worship must be a spiritual communion with Him. Moreover, God has revealed Himself through His Word, which is now inscripturated in the Bible and must be understood through a biblical-theological framework. Using a qualitative research method with a literature study approach, this study seeks to explore the meaning of true worship in John 4:23 to obtain theologically sound and accountable findings. The author argues that the biblical concept of true worship in John 4:23 provides a theological foundation for the congregation to grow in knowing God through a life of genuine spiritual devotion. This study provides a fresh perspective, highlighting that the practice of authentic worship holds a vital role in the knowledge of God.
Dosa sebagai Ὀφείλημα: Telaah Leksikal Doa Bapa Kami dan Relasinya dengan Konsep חוֹב (ḥōb) dalam Tradisi Ibrani Didit Yuliantono Adi; Sulistiono Sulistiono; Sukarno Hadi
Sabda: Jurnal Teologi Kristen Vol 7, No 1 (2026): MEI
Publisher : Sekolah Tinggi Teologi Nusantara

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.55097/sabda.v7i1.326

Abstract

This article examines the concept of sin as debt in the Lord’s Prayer through a lexical study of the Greek term opheilēma and an exploration of its conceptual roots in the Hebrew tradition. The study challenges the common assumption that sin is resolved simply by ceasing sinful behavior. Using a qualitative approach that integrates philological analysis, historical exegesis, and a review of recent scholarship, the research demonstrates that opheilēma in Matthew 6:12 refers to an unresolved moral and relational obligation rather than an abstract moral failure. This finding aligns with the Old Testament understanding of sin as a burden of responsibility that requires relational restoration. Consequently, forgiveness emerges not as a mere emotional response but as an act that resolves obligation and restores relationship. The study highlights the conceptual continuity between the Old and New Testaments and offers a theological correction to reductionist views of sin in contemporary Christian discourse.ABstrakArtikel ini bertujuan untuk  mengkaji konsep dosa sebagai hutang dalam Doa Bapa Kami melalui studi leksikal atas istilah Yunani opheilēma.
